#57279d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#57279d is composed of 34.1% red, 15.3%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.6% cyan, 75.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 264.4 degrees, a saturation of 60.2% and a lightness of 38.4%. #57279d color hex could be obtained by blending #ae4eff with #00003b.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#57279d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#57279d has RGB values of R:87, G:39,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 5711773.

Shades and Tints of #57279d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090410 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
